Major C W M Feilden DSO


Cecil William Montague Feilden was born in Quebec on 13 Jan 1863. He was the son of Lt-General Randle Joseph Feilden and Jean Campbell Hozier. He was a lieutenant in the Greys on 2 Aug 1882 and promoted to captain on 14 Feb 1891. He was appointed extra ADC to Lt-General and Governor of Ireland from 2 Feb 1891 to 17 Aug 1892, and again from 3 Oct 1892 to 31 Oct 1895. He was Private Secretary to the Commander-in-Chief from 1 Nov 1895 to 15 Jan 1897. The photo shows him in the undress uniform of a staff officer. He commanded A Squadron in South Africa. He was gazetted major on 29 Oct 1901, and for the DSO on 4 Nov 1901. He was fatally wounded at the battle at Klippan on 18 Feb 1902 and died on 20 Feb. Klippan was the last battle fought by the Greys in the Boer War and caused many casualties amongst the men of A Squadron.
